At Governors Awards, Lawrence’s $500,000 diamond earrings to go under Sotheby’s hammer

Hollywood star Jennifer Lawrence has not only dazzled on the red carpet but also become a prominent part of the ongoing promotion of valuable jewelry at international auctions. Her recent appearance at the Governors Awards in Los Angeles is a prime example.

As a Dior brand ambassador, Lawrence wore an off-shoulder white silk gown designed by Jonathan Anderson. However, attention was drawn to her rare 1987 diamond earrings, valued between $300,000 and $500,000. Designed by American jeweler Joel Arthur Rosenthal, these earrings are set to be auctioned at Sotheby’s in New York next month.

This was not the first time Lawrence wore auctioned jewelry. Earlier this month, she appeared at the New York premiere of her new movie Die My Love wearing a gold necklace with enamel detailing by David Webb, valued between $25,000 and $35,000. This too will be auctioned at Sotheby’s.

Sotheby’s has previously lent jewelry to many celebrities, including Rihanna and Priyanka Chopra Jonas, which later sold for record prices at auction. Experts believe that due to a decline in high-value art sales, Sotheby’s is now trying new strategies to attract audiences and buyers. Promoting auctioned jewelry through celebrities is part of this strategy.

According to research firm ArtTactic, sales in the high-value art market have declined over the past three years due to inflation and global instability. Historic auction houses like Sotheby’s are thus leveraging celebrity popularity to explore new opportunities.
